Recruitment & HR Specialist

Join our mission of providing life-changing experiences that enhance independence and self-esteem for children and adults with disabilities!

The Recruitment & HR Specialist is responsible for full-cycle recruitment of employees and volunteers at True Friends. This role works with hiring managers to understand staffing needs, generate qualified applicants, manage the hiring process, and ensure a positive experience for candidates from application through onboarding.

In this role, your work directly supports True Friends' ability to fulfil its mission. You'll build relationships with candidates, hiring managers, and other partners while helping manage the recruitment process from application through onboarding. You'll spend your time recruiting, connecting with candidates, supporting onboarding, and contributing to other HR projects, giving you the opportunity to make a meaningful impact while enjoying a varied and people-focused role.

Key Responsibilities

  • Partner with hiring managers and Marketing to identify recruitment needs and generate qualified applicants
  • Manage full-cycle recruitment, including posting opportunities, sourcing candidates, reviewing applications, interviewing, extending offers, and providing onboarding support as needed
  • Coordinate and participate in recruitment events, including occasional evenings and weekends
  • Manage the recruitment process through applicant tracking system(s), ensuring an organized, efficient, and positive candidate experience
  • Conduct background and reference checks for potential candidates
  • Ensure new hires complete required employment paperwork and documentation
  • Build and maintain relationships with hiring mangers and other recruitment partners
  • Perform other duties as assigned
